Beyond the numbers

What each city asks you to trade

Costs and scores help narrow the choice. These practical strengths and limitations finish the picture.

São Paulo Brazil

Strengths

  • Thriving cultural scene
  • Excellent nightlife
  • Affordable compared to global hubs
  • Great food diversity
  • Strong coworking infrastructure
  • Nature escapes nearby

Trade-offs

  • High crime rates
  • Traffic congestion
  • Language barrier (Portuguese)
  • Uneven internet reliability
  • Air pollution
  • Complex bureaucracy

Common visa routes

  • Tourist visa (90 days, extendable)
  • Digital Nomad Visa (1 year)
  • Mercosul residency (fast track for neighbors)
Puerto Viejo Costa Rica

Strengths

  • Stunning Caribbean beaches and surf breaks
  • Lively reggae and Afro-Caribbean culture
  • Affordable lifestyle compared to rest of Costa Rica
  • Strong expat and digital nomad community
  • Abundant wildlife and jungle adventures
  • Laid-back, stress-free atmosphere

Trade-offs

  • Unreliable internet with frequent outages
  • Limited healthcare facilities (clinic only, hospital far)
  • High humidity and mosquito presence year-round
  • Few coworking spaces; most work from cafes
  • Bumpy roads and limited public transport
  • Occasional petty theft, especially at night

Common visa routes

  • Tourist visa (90 days)
  • Border run to Panama
  • Digital nomad visa (pending)
